How to use params in class component
Web19 nov. 2024 · We have explained how to fix the Use Params In Class Based Component problem by using a wide variety of examples taken from the real world. How do you find params in class components? To access the match params in a class component, either convert to a function component or write your own custom withRouter Higher Order … WebSummary. navigate and push accept an optional second argument to let you pass parameters to the route you are navigating to. For example: navigation.navigate ('RouteName', { paramName: 'value' }). You can read the params through route.params inside a screen. You can update the screen's params with navigation.setParams.
How to use params in class component
Did you know?
Web17 jun. 2024 · Since hooks wont work with class based components you can wrap it in a function and pass the properties along. In this tutorial, I will show you that how to use useparams hook in react class component. You know that we can use react hook only functional components. Web16 jun. 2024 · Issue. Route components no longer contain route props (history, location, and match) in react-router-dom v6, hence the current approach is to utilise React hooks “versions” of these within the displayed components.React Hooks, on the other hand, cannot be used in class components.. Let’s assume that you have the following project …
Web28 feb. 2024 · Pass params to a route by putting them in an object as a second parameter to the navigation.navigate function: By using the props object, you can read the params in your screen as follows: component: this.props.navigation.state.params. Open screen/Blog.js file and place the following code inside of it. WebThe constructor () method is called with the props, as arguments, and you should always start by calling the super (props) before anything else, this will initiate the parent's constructor method and allows the component to inherit methods from its parent ( React.Component ). Example: Get your own React.js Server
Web13 aug. 2024 · The query parameters is indicated by the first ? in a URI. In this article, I’m going to share how to get the query params in React. Let’s get started: Table of Contents. React Router v5; React Router v4; Class-based Component; React Router v5. In react-router v5, we can get the query parameter using useLocation hook. WebReact Props. React Props are like function arguments in JavaScript and attributes in HTML. To send props into a component, use the same syntax as HTML attributes: Example Get your own React.js Server. Add a "brand" attribute to the Car element: const myElement = ; The component receives the argument as a props object ...
WebHow to use component-classes - 9 common examples To help you get started, we’ve selected a few component-classes examples, based on popular ways it is used in public projects. Secure your code as it's written.
Web9 feb. 2024 · How to extract params from URL javascript? Method 1: Using the URLSearchParams Object The URLSearchParams is an interface used to provide methods that can be used to work with an URL. The URL string is first separated to get only the parameters portion of the URL. The split () method is used on the given URL with the … how deep are septic leach fieldsWebGetting the URL params. To get the url parameter from a current route, we can use the useParams () hook in react router v5. Now, we can access the :id param value from a Users component using the useParams () hook. In React router v4, you can access it using the props.match.params.id. In class-based components, you can access it like this. how deep are serviceberry rootsWeb24 sep. 2024 · You can use the Link component or an HTML anchor tag if you want to redirect to an external link with React Router. ... If you want to learn more about React, here’s an article on how to get URL params in React (with React Router V5/V6 and without). how deep are septic drain linesWeb1 apr. 2024 · In a class based component, we can do it like import React, { Component } from 'react'; class Student extends Component { render () { const { studentId } = this.props.match.params; return ( StudentId: { studentId } ); } } export default Student; Alternatively, you can use withRouter HOC. how many questions on slp praxisWebClass parameters are typically used for the following purposes: To customize the behavior of the various data type classes (such as providing validation information). To define user-specific information about a class definition. A class parameter is simply an arbitrary name-value pair; you can use it to store any information you like about a class. how deep are shelves for booksWebreact send arguments to component; using props in a class react component's method; react pass props data from component to App; using or in props react; react pass props in; use propse on class component; passingcomponent as props in react js; how to pass down a react variable as props; pass component as prop example react; pass … how many questions on nclex pnWeb8 mrt. 2024 · To use useParams() inside class component with react-router-dom, we can use the withRouter higher order component. For instance, we write. import React from "react"; import { withRouter } from "react-router"; class TaskDetail extends React.Component { componentDidMount() { const { id } = this.props.match.params; … how many questions on nbcot exam